LOW ANTIMONY LEAD-BASED ALLOYS AND USE THEREOF;ALLIAGES AU PLOMB A FAIBLE TENEUR D'ANTIMOINE, ET LEUR EMPLOI
A lead base alloy containing 1.0%-2.8% antimony, 0.1%-0.4% tin, .005%-.03% selenium, and .004%-.012% silver is disclosed for lead-acid battery grids, the grids in turn being particularly useful for preparation of maintenance-free batteries having superior characteristics. CARRIER FOR MUSIC PLAYER
An adjustable band fits around a wearer's upper arm for carrying, in a pocket of the band, a musical tape player, radio or the like, which cannot otherwise conveniently be worn or carried. An object in the pocket is protected during outdoor use. Additional pockets can be provided. |
